  • Boy Scouts expected to lift ban on gay adult leaders on Monday

    07/27/2015 4:54:16 AM PDT · by Zakeet · 58 replies
    Reuters ^ | July 27, 2015 | Marice Richter
    The Boy Scouts of America is expected to end its ban on gay adult leaders on Monday, dismantling a policy that has deeply divided the membership of the 105-year-old Texas-based organization. The Boy Scouts National Executive Board will consider a resolution that was unanimously approved by the organization’s executive committee on July 13. The organization is urging an end to the ban because of "sea change in the law with respect to gay rights."

  • Caitlyn Jenner can use the ladies’ room (as per new OSHA mandate)

    06/09/2015 5:44:58 AM PDT · by Zakeet · 45 replies
    NY Post ^ | June 9, 2015 | Bob Fredericks
    It’s official — Caitlyn Jenner can now use the ladies’ room. The US Department of Labor has issued guidelines to private businesses that say transgender employees should be allowed to decide for themselves whether to use the men’s or ladies’ room. “The core belief underlying these policies is that all employees should be permitted to use the facilities that correspond with their gender identity,” according to OSHA guidelines released by the Occupational Safety and Health Administration of the Labor Department. The National Center for Transgender Equality had requested the guidance.
